Subject: Re: [PATCH RESEND 06/16] Thermal: set upper and lower limits
Date: Wed, 25 Jul 2012 22:14:42 +0200	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<201207252214.43030.rjw@sisk.pl>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<1343182273-32096-7-git-send-email-rui.zhang@intel.com>

On Wednesday, July 25, 2012, Zhang Rui wrote:
> set upper and lower limits when binding
> a thermal cooling device to a thermal zone device.
> 
> Signed-off-by: Zhang Rui <rui.zhang@intel.com>
> ---
>  Documentation/thermal/sysfs-api.txt |    9 +++++-
>  drivers/acpi/thermal.c              |   53 +++++++++++++++++++++++------------
>  drivers/platform/x86/acerhdf.c      |    3 +-
>  drivers/thermal/thermal_sys.c       |   23 ++++++++++-----
>  include/linux/thermal.h             |    5 +++-
>  5 files changed, 65 insertions(+), 28 deletions(-)
> 
> diff --git a/Documentation/thermal/sysfs-api.txt b/Documentation/thermal/sysfs-api.txt
> index c087dbc..ca1a1a3 100644
> --- a/Documentation/thermal/sysfs-api.txt
> +++ b/Documentation/thermal/sysfs-api.txt
> @@ -84,7 +84,8 @@ temperature) and throttle appropriate devices.
>  
>  1.3 interface for binding a thermal zone device with a thermal cooling device
>  1.3.1 int thermal_zone_bind_cooling_device(struct thermal_zone_device *tz,
> -		int trip, struct thermal_cooling_device *cdev);
> +	int trip, struct thermal_cooling_device *cdev,
> +	unsigned long upper, unsigned long lower);
>  
>      This interface function bind a thermal cooling device to the certain trip
>      point of a thermal zone device.
> @@ -93,6 +94,12 @@ temperature) and throttle appropriate devices.
>      cdev: thermal cooling device
>      trip: indicates which trip point the cooling devices is associated with
>  	  in this thermal zone.
> +    upper:the Maximum cooling state for this trip point.
> +          THERMAL_NO_LIMIT means no upper limit,
> +	  and the cooling device can be in max_state.
> +    lower:the Minimum cooling state can be used for this trip point.
> +          THERMAL_NO_LIMIT means no lower limit,
> +	  and the cooling device can be in cooling state 0.
>  
>  1.3.2 int thermal_zone_unbind_cooling_device(struct thermal_zone_device *tz,
>  		int trip, struct thermal_cooling_device *cdev);
> diff --git a/drivers/acpi/thermal.c b/drivers/acpi/thermal.c
> index 8275e7b..0154eac 100644
> --- a/drivers/acpi/thermal.c
> +++ b/drivers/acpi/thermal.c
> @@ -727,11 +727,9 @@ static int thermal_notify(struct thermal_zone_device *thermal, int trip,
>  	return 0;
>  }
>  
> -typedef int (*cb)(struct thermal_zone_device *, int,
> -		  struct thermal_cooling_device *);
>  static int acpi_thermal_cooling_device_cb(struct thermal_zone_device *thermal,
>  					struct thermal_cooling_device *cdev,
> -					cb action)
> +					bool bind)
>  {
>  	struct acpi_device *device = cdev->devdata;
>  	struct acpi_thermal *tz = thermal->devdata;
> @@ -755,11 +753,19 @@ static int acpi_thermal_cooling_device_cb(struct thermal_zone_device *thermal,
>  		    i++) {
>  			handle = tz->trips.passive.devices.handles[i];
>  			status = acpi_bus_get_device(handle, &dev);
> -			if (ACPI_SUCCESS(status) && (dev == device)) {
> -				result = action(thermal, trip, cdev);
> -				if (result)
> -					goto failed;
> -			}
> +			if (ACPI_FAILURE(status) || dev != device)
> +				continue;
> +			if (bind)
> +				result =
> +					thermal_zone_bind_cooling_device
> +					(thermal, trip, cdev,
> +					 THERMAL_NO_LIMIT, THERMAL_NO_LIMIT);
> +			else
> +				result =
> +					thermal_zone_unbind_cooling_device
> +					(thermal, trip, cdev);
> +			if (result)
> +				goto failed;
>  		}
>  	}
>  
> @@ -772,11 +778,17 @@ static int acpi_thermal_cooling_device_cb(struct thermal_zone_device *thermal,
>  		    j++) {
>  			handle = tz->trips.active[i].devices.handles[j];
>  			status = acpi_bus_get_device(handle, &dev);
> -			if (ACPI_SUCCESS(status) && (dev == device)) {
> -				result = action(thermal, trip, cdev);
> -				if (result)
> -					goto failed;
> -			}
> +			if (ACPI_FAILURE(status) || dev != device)
> +				continue;
> +			if (bind)
> +				result = thermal_zone_bind_cooling_device
> +					(thermal, trip, cdev,
> +					 THERMAL_NO_LIMIT, THERMAL_NO_LIMIT);
> +			else
> +				result = thermal_zone_unbind_cooling_device
> +					(thermal, trip, cdev);
> +			if (result)
> +				goto failed;
>  		}
>  	}
>  
> @@ -784,7 +796,14 @@ static int acpi_thermal_cooling_device_cb(struct thermal_zone_device *thermal,
>  		handle = tz->devices.handles[i];
>  		status = acpi_bus_get_device(handle, &dev);
>  		if (ACPI_SUCCESS(status) && (dev == device)) {
> -			result = action(thermal, -1, cdev);
> +			if (bind)
> +				result = thermal_zone_bind_cooling_device
> +						(thermal, -1, cdev,
> +						 THERMAL_NO_LIMIT,
> +						 THERMAL_NO_LIMIT);
> +			else
> +				result = thermal_zone_unbind_cooling_device
> +						(thermal, -1, cdev);
>  			if (result)
>  				goto failed;
>  		}
> @@ -798,16 +817,14 @@ static int
>  acpi_thermal_bind_cooling_device(struct thermal_zone_device *thermal,
>  					struct thermal_cooling_device *cdev)
>  {
> -	return acpi_thermal_cooling_device_cb(thermal, cdev,
> -				thermal_zone_bind_cooling_device);
> +	return acpi_thermal_cooling_device_cb(thermal, cdev, 1);

That should be

+	return acpi_thermal_cooling_device_cb(thermal, cdev, true);

I suppose.

>  }
>  
>  static int
>  acpi_thermal_unbind_cooling_device(struct thermal_zone_device *thermal,
>  					struct thermal_cooling_device *cdev)
>  {
> -	return acpi_thermal_cooling_device_cb(thermal, cdev,
> -				thermal_zone_unbind_cooling_device);
> +	return acpi_thermal_cooling_device_cb(thermal, cdev, 0);

And that should be

+	return acpi_thermal_cooling_device_cb(thermal, cdev, false);

>  }
>  
>  static const struct thermal_zone_device_ops acpi_thermal_zone_ops = {
> diff --git a/drivers/platform/x86/acerhdf.c b/drivers/platform/x86/acerhdf.c
> index 39abb15..a207466 100644
> --- a/drivers/platform/x86/acerhdf.c
> +++ b/drivers/platform/x86/acerhdf.c
> @@ -329,7 +329,8 @@ static int acerhdf_bind(struct thermal_zone_device *thermal,
>  	if (cdev != cl_dev)
>  		return 0;
>  
> -	if (thermal_zone_bind_cooling_device(thermal, 0, cdev)) {
> +	if (thermal_zone_bind_cooling_device(thermal, 0, cdev,
> +			THERMAL_NO_LIMIT, THERMAL_NO_LIMIT)) {
>  		pr_err("error binding cooling dev\n");
>  		return -EINVAL;
>  	}
> diff --git a/drivers/thermal/thermal_sys.c b/drivers/thermal/thermal_sys.c
> index 008e2eb..62b4279 100644
> --- a/drivers/thermal/thermal_sys.c
> +++ b/drivers/thermal/thermal_sys.c
> @@ -315,8 +315,9 @@ passive_store(struct device *dev, struct device_attribute *attr,
>  			if (!strncmp("Processor", cdev->type,
>  				     sizeof("Processor")))
>  				thermal_zone_bind_cooling_device(tz,
> -								 THERMAL_TRIPS_NONE,
> -								 cdev);
> +						THERMAL_TRIPS_NONE, cdev,
> +						THERMAL_NO_LIMIT,
> +						THERMAL_NO_LIMIT);
>  		}
>  		mutex_unlock(&thermal_list_lock);
>  		if (!tz->passive_delay)
> @@ -801,7 +802,8 @@ static void thermal_zone_device_check(struct work_struct *work)
>   */
>  int thermal_zone_bind_cooling_device(struct thermal_zone_device *tz,
>  				     int trip,
> -				     struct thermal_cooling_device *cdev)
> +				     struct thermal_cooling_device *cdev,
> +				     unsigned long upper, unsigned long lower)
>  {
>  	struct thermal_cooling_device_instance *dev;
>  	struct thermal_cooling_device_instance *pos;
> @@ -825,6 +827,15 @@ int thermal_zone_bind_cooling_device(struct thermal_zone_device *tz,
>  	if (tz != pos1 || cdev != pos2)
>  		return -EINVAL;
>  
> +	cdev->ops->get_max_state(cdev, &max_state);
> +
> +	/* lower default 0, upper default max_state */
> +	lower = lower == THERMAL_NO_LIMIT ? 0 : lower;
> +	upper = upper == THERMAL_NO_LIMIT ? max_state : upper;
> +
> +	if (lower > upper || upper > max_state)
> +		return -EINVAL;
> +
>  	dev =
>  	    kzalloc(sizeof(struct thermal_cooling_device_instance), GFP_KERNEL);
>  	if (!dev)
> @@ -832,10 +843,8 @@ int thermal_zone_bind_cooling_device(struct thermal_zone_device *tz,
>  	dev->tz = tz;
>  	dev->cdev = cdev;
>  	dev->trip = trip;
> -
> -	cdev->ops->get_max_state(cdev, &max_state);
> -	dev->upper = max_state;
> -	dev->lower = 0;
> +	dev->upper = upper;
> +	dev->lower = lower;
>  
>  	result = get_idr(&tz->idr, &tz->lock, &dev->id);
>  	if (result)
> diff --git a/include/linux/thermal.h b/include/linux/thermal.h
> index cfc8d90..a43b12c 100644
> --- a/include/linux/thermal.h
> +++ b/include/linux/thermal.h
> @@ -75,6 +75,8 @@ struct thermal_cooling_device_ops {
>  	int (*set_cur_state) (struct thermal_cooling_device *, unsigned long);
>  };
>  
> +#define THERMAL_NO_LIMIT -1UL /* no upper/lower limit requirement */
> +
>  #define THERMAL_TRIPS_NONE -1
>  #define THERMAL_MAX_TRIPS 12
>  #define THERMAL_NAME_LENGTH 20
> @@ -157,7 +159,8 @@ struct thermal_zone_device *thermal_zone_device_register(char *, int, int,
>  void thermal_zone_device_unregister(struct thermal_zone_device *);
>  
>  int thermal_zone_bind_cooling_device(struct thermal_zone_device *, int,
> -				     struct thermal_cooling_device *);
> +				     struct thermal_cooling_device *,
> +				     unsigned long, unsigned long);
>  int thermal_zone_unbind_cooling_device(struct thermal_zone_device *, int,
>  				       struct thermal_cooling_device *);
>  void thermal_zone_device_update(struct thermal_zone_device *);
> 

Looks good apart from the above nits (arguably minor).

Thanks,
Rafael
